Submersible centrifugal aerator with stirring device
Technical Field
The utility model relates to a centrifugal aeration machine technical field of dive specifically is a take agitating unit's centrifugal aeration machine of dive.
Background
The submersible centrifugal aerator is widely applied to industrial wastewater, livestock wastewater treatment and sewage pipeline and an aeration tank for treating factory wastewater by using an activated sludge method, and can be used independently or in combination, but in the prior art, the submersible centrifugal aerator is not provided with a stirring and filtering device, and can be directly used in large-area water areas such as an oxidation pond, a river channel, a fish pond, an activated sludge pond, a sludge storage well, a balance pond and the like, because the solid-liquid concentration ratio in a medium is large, and some submersible centrifugal aerators also have fibrous objects, the impeller of the submersible centrifugal aerator is easy to block, so that the gas-water ratio in a mixed gas chamber can not reach the standard ratio, and the mixed gas disk and the mixed gas chamber can not form negative pressure, so that sewage can not form upper and lower circulating flow, and oxygen in the air can not be rapidly transferred into liquid, thereby affecting the sewage treatment result.

Referring to fig. 1-3, the present invention provides a technical solution: a submersible centrifugal aerator with a stirring device comprises a gas mixing disc 7 and a support plate 8, wherein the gas mixing disc 7 is fixedly arranged at the top of the support plate 8, a gas mixing chamber 3 is fixedly arranged at the top of the gas mixing disc 7, a submersible motor 4 is fixedly arranged at the top of the gas mixing chamber 3 through a bolt 10, an air inlet pipe 6 is fixedly arranged at the right side of the top of the gas mixing chamber 3, a silencer 5 is fixedly arranged at the top of the air inlet pipe 6, the silencer 5 is arranged at the top of the air inlet pipe 6, so that the centrifugal aerator reduces noise when sucking air, the effect of reducing noise is achieved, support columns 9 are fixedly arranged at both sides of the bottom of the support plate 8, the two support columns 9 are arranged, a cross beam rod 17 is fixedly arranged between the two support columns 9, a stirrer 1 is fixedly arranged in the middle of the bottom of the gas mixing disc 7, the output end of the submersible motor 4 is fixedly provided with a rotating shaft 18, the rotating shaft 18 penetrates through the mixing air chamber 3 and the mixing air disc 7, an impeller 2 is fixedly arranged on the rotating shaft 18 in the mixing air disc 7, blades 11 are fixedly arranged on two sides of the impeller 2, a coupler 16 is fixedly arranged at one end of the rotating shaft 18 far away from the submersible motor 4, the effects of buffering and shock absorption are achieved by installing the coupler 16, the bottom of the coupler 16 is fixedly provided with a connecting rod 15, stirring blades 12 are fixedly arranged on two sides of the connecting rod 15, stirring teeth 13 are fixedly arranged at the bottom of the stirring blades 12, the effects of stirring and crushing are achieved by installing the stirring blades 12 and the stirring teeth 13, a filter screen 14 is fixedly arranged at the bottom of the connecting rod 15, large impurities and fibrous objects in water are effectively filtered by arranging the filter screen 14, the filter screen 14 is installed on the connecting rod, the effect of reducing sundries adsorbed on the filter screen 14 is achieved, and the problem that the impeller 2 of the centrifugal aerator is blocked and damaged due to the fact that solid-liquid concentration in fibrous objects and media is high is solved through the matching arrangement among the filter screen 14, the stirring blades 12 and the stirring teeth 13.
The working principle is as follows: the submersible centrifugal aerator is put into water, the submersible motor 4 starts to work after the power supply is switched on, so that the rotating shaft 18 and the connecting rod 15 are driven to rotate, water is filtered by the filter screen 14, the stirring of the stirring blades 12 and the stirring teeth 13 enters the mixed gas disk 7, air enters the mixed gas chamber 3 from the air inlet pipe 6, and then the air is stirred with the water in the mixed gas disk 7 and then discharged.
